Assistant Brand Manager - TOM Organic

At Essity, we are dedicated to breaking barriers to well-being and becoming the undisputed global leader in health and hygiene. Join our team in Springvale and contribute to our mission of enhancing health and hygiene standards worldwide.

About the Role:

The Assistant Brand Manager, TOM Organic, plays a key role in shaping the future of one of our most purpose-led and premium brands. You’ll support the growth of the Period Care portfolio (Pads, Tampons, Liners, Period Underwear, and Cups) across Australia and New Zealand, contributing to both local and global marketing efforts.

This role is about more than just execution, you’ll support, develop, and deliver marketing strategies that unlock growth in revenue and profit, using your curiosity and commercial mindset to uncover opportunities through consumer and category insights.

TOM Organic is a premium, purpose-driven brand with a growing and highly engaged consumer base. With a flat structure and collaborative culture, you’ll have a real voice and the chance to make meaningful impact from day one.

You’ll be supported by a leader who’s passionate about mentoring and getting the team involved in a full 360° view of the business. If you bring professional maturity, initiative, and a genuine eagerness to learn, this is the kind of place where you’ll thrive.

What You Will Do:

  • Support and help implement annual brand plans to drive sales, profit, and market share

  • Ensure activities align with brand positioning and identity

  • Support NPD from concept to launch, using consumer insights within a Stage & Gate framework

  • Support comms across media channels (TV/OLV, Digital, Social, CRM, BTL) and post-campaign reviews

  • Create engaging social and EDM calendars; coordinate with in-house design

  • Contribute to brand audits, research, and planning for 1- and 3-year innovation pipeline

  • Monitor trends and identify opportunities for growth and improvement

  • Build strong cross-functional and agency partnerships

  • Manage A&P budget effectively; look for ways to improve marketing ROI and minimise write-offs

Who You Are:

Ideally you bring 2+ years’ experience in marketing or a related field with Tertiary qualifications in Marketing, Communications, or a related discipline. You will have:

  • Strong analytical and strategic thinking with the ability to track and manage brand performance

  • Proven project management skills with experience coordinating cross-functional teams and driving projects through to completion

  • Excellent communication and influencing skills; ability to build strong internal and external relationships

  • Commercial mindset with financial awareness and the ability to prioritise in a fast-paced environment

  • Proactive, curious, and hands-on with a can-do attitude

  • Resilient and positive approach to challenges; team player with collaborative style

Experience using data systems like IRI and familiarity with the Stage & Gate process would be an advantage, though we are willing to provide training in these areas.

What you need to know about the Melbourne Tech Scene

Home to 650 biotech companies, 10 major research institutes and nine universities, Melbourne is among one of the top cities for biotech. In fact, some of the greatest medical advancements were conceptualized and developed here, including Symex Lab's "lab-on-a-chip" solution that monitors hormones to predict ovulation for conception, and Denteric's vaccine for periodontal gum disease. Yet, the thousands of people working in the city's healthtech sector are just getting started, to say nothing of the tech advancements across all other sectors.
